Currently there is no way to change "Active Time" if it is incorrect - for example if eclipse is left open while doing something other than the active task. Ideally, one would deactivate the task, but it is very easy to forget to do this and once it is missed there is no way to correct the counter. Additionally, it would be good for mylar to detect that eclipse (or the entire PC) is idle, and automatically deactivate the task.
While the task timings are always derived from interaction and cannot be directly edited, we do understand this use case and plan on addressing it with bug#121337. Please feel free to comment if your specific use case isn't addressed. Mylar does currently track inactivity (timeout is currently 2 minutes). That said there are known problems with the activity timing and are scheduled to be fixed for Mylar 2.0 release (bug#174029). The thing that this is missing is timing activity outside of the workbench. For that we provide an extension point: bug#135668 *** This bug has been marked as a duplicate of bug 121337 ***
